## Changelog — Doodlegraph 4.2

Heads up, future maintainers: we finally changed the undo/redo defaults. The old 50-step history cap was from the Bramblewood-era laptops and made no sense anymore, so it's bumped way up, and redo stacks now survive a document reload instead of getting nuked. Snapshot compression is on by default too, which keeps memory sane on big diagrams. If users complain about anything weird with history, check these first before blaming the canvas layer. The new default configuration values ship as follows.

settings of fajop-fahap:
[holeth]
port = 9300
team = juleth
host = holeth.tolvaqsoft.example
region = south-4
access_code = ac_4bcdf6
timeout_ms = 500

OFF-SITE RUN CHECKLIST — Item 9

Quarterly stock-count ledger, Vensmoor site.

- Ledger sealed in tamper-evident pouch; seal number logged.
- No copies made. Original only.
- Receiving site (Caldren Annex): verify seal intact on arrival, sign transit card, file within one hour.
- Report any seal break immediately to the audit desk; do not open the pouch.
- Courier carries ledger in hand, not in vehicle overnight.

The hand-over instruction follows.

courier memo of yawep-yafog: the pramir ulaix courier leaves the ulavan aldix frair zorok oliiel joreth rusdor fenvan ledger at gate 1305 under passcode 514738

## Account Recovery — Trailnote Offline Mode

When a surveyor's Trailnote app has been offline for 30+ days, their local credentials expire and sync refuses to resume. Don't make them wipe the device — all their unsynced field data lives there! Instead, open the support console, pick "Offline Reinstate," and enter their handle. The console will ask for the support team's shared recovery passphrase before issuing a reinstatement token. Use the one below.

unlock words, bagaf-fajeg: zorael-kelax-fraath-quenix-eliok-sileth-aldmir-wenir-druiel